Collaboration vs. Competition

In the home services industry, the strategic shift from competition to collaboration, including cross-industry partnerships, has proven to be a game-changer. These types of collaborations not only foster innovation and access to new markets but also enable companies to leverage marketing and revenue opportunities that were previously untapped.

  1. Integrating Diverse Skills and Resources: By partnering with businesses outside their immediate sector, home services companies can adopt new technologies and methodologies. For example, a partnership between a home security company and a digital technology firm can integrate AI-driven security systems into residential projects, enhancing their offerings.

  2. Innovative Solutions Through Industry Convergence: Collaborating with sectors like retail or energy can create innovative, integrated solutions that attract a wider range of customers. A home services company partnering with an energy company could offer energy-efficient installations, tapping into the growing market of environmentally conscious consumers.

  3. Expanding Customer Base with New Segments: Cross-industry partnerships, such as those with real estate firms, open doors to new customer segments. Home services companies can gain direct access to homeowners in need of immediate renovations or maintenance services, broadening their market reach.

Examples of Potential Partnerships

  • Roofing and Solar Tech Firm: A roofing company might partner with a solar tech firm to offer bundled services, expanding their market to eco-conscious consumers.

  • Pool Installers and Landscape Designers: A pool design and installation company could collaborate with landscape designers to offer comprehensive backyard solutions, enhancing customer experience and increasing referrals.

  • HVAC and Smart Home Developers: An HVAC provider might consider partnering with a smart home developer to integrate smart technologies, attracting tech-savvy customers and improving energy management.

These examples show that collaboration enables businesses to tap into new technologies and markets and sets them up for long-term success, demonstrating that a cooperative approach can be more beneficial than a competitive one in the home services industry.

Joint Marketing Strategies

Collaborative marketing efforts, such as co-hosted events, bundled service offerings, and joint promotional campaigns, can significantly increase reach and reduce marketing costs. Digital tools and social media platforms are excellent for amplifying these efforts, attracting more customers than solo campaigns.

These partnerships often come with revenue-sharing agreements, where both parties benefit from the increased business generated through joint efforts. For instance, a home maintenance company could enter a revenue-sharing agreement with a manufacturer of home appliances, where each service call generated through the manufacturer’s referrals includes a commission.

Measuring the Success of Partnerships

To gauge the effectiveness of a partnership, key performance indicators (KPIs) like customer acquisition costs, customer satisfaction scores, and joint revenue growth should be monitored. Regular performance reviews can help refine strategies and ensure that both businesses benefit from the alliance.
